In vitro studies have demonstrated that secretin can stimulate the release of parathyroid hormone (PTH), but reports concerning its effects on PTH and calcium in vivo are contradictory. To examine this question further, a bolus injection of secretin (75 IU) was given to 12 normal subjects and 10 patients with primary hyperparathyroidism (HPT). Six of the patients had multiple endocrine neoplasia and five had endocrine pancreatic tumours (EPT). Three normocalcaemic patients with EPT were also included in the study. The mean serum gastrin level rose significantly (from 19 to 40 pmol/l, p less than 0.01) within 15 min of secretin injection in the normal subjects. HPT patients without EPT had a somewhat higher mean basal level of gastrin (39 pmol/l, p less than 0.05 compared with controls), but it did not increase significantly after the secretin bolus. In six EPT patients the gastrin concentrations rose by more than 300 pmol/l. Although secretin had a biological capacity to release gastrin, it had no discernible effects on either serum PTH or serum calcium in any of the groups studied. Nor were any changes in PTH or calcium observed when secretin was given as a continuous infusion (3 IU/kg/h) over 90 min. Thus, our data do not support the concept that secretin, in vivo, is a secretagogue of PTH.

Immunoreactive ACTH was found in almost all tissue extracts of lung carcinoma from patients without clinical evidence of Cushing's syndrome; i.e. 14 of 15 primary tumors, nine of nine metastatic lymph nodes, and four of four metastatic liver nodules contained immunoreactive ACTH. The incidence of ACTH in extracts of other tumor types was much lower. Comparable normal tissues contained no detectable ACTH. Immunoreactive growth hormone, parathyroid hormone, or gastrin was not found in the same carcinoma tissue. The predominant form of ACTH in the tumor extracts was big ACTH. In pituitary extracts little ACTH predominated.53% of 83 patients with lung carcinoma had afternoon plasma ACTH levels greater than 150 pg/ml; more than 90% of plasmas containing less than 150 pg/ml were obtained from patients who had received radiation therapy or chemotherapy. 31% of 45 patients with chronic obstructive pulmonary disease (COPD), 28% of 25 patients with other severe lung disease, and 6% of 33 controls had elevated values. Big ACTH predominated in the plasma of patients with lung carcinoma or COPD having elevated ACTH levels. Tissue from the lung of a smoking dog with atypical histologic changes contained immunoreactive ACTH, almost exclusively in the big form, while tissue from another smoking dog that was histologically normal contained no ACTH. Thus ACTH may be present even in precancerous lung lesions. These studies suggest that serial plasma ACTH levels may be of value in screening for, and/or management of, patients with carcinoma of the lung.

The release of immunoreactive gastrin and somatostatin form the gastric antrum was studied in anesthetized pigs after parathyroid hormone (PTH) infusion into the antral circulation. PTH (40 units/20 min) was infused into the right gastro-epiploic artery. Blood was sampled from the right gastro-epiploic vein (antral venous blood) and from the superior vena cava (mixed venous blood). The basal gastrin concentration in antral venous blood was 17 times higher than that in mixed venous blood (1220 + 367 versus 71 +25 pmol/1, mean +SE). The somatostatin concentrations in antral and mixed venous blood were 127 +20 and 82 +23 pg/ml (mean +SE), respectively. After PTH infusion the gastrin level both in antral and mixed venous blood increased significantly without inducing systemic hypercalcemia. PTH infusion did not significantly influence the somatostatin level either in antral venous blood or in mixed venous blood. The findings demonstrate that PTH can induce gastrin release from the gastric antrum without concomitant systemic hypercalcemia and that this release of gastrin is not accompanied by a change in the somatostatin level in antral venous blood.

The influence of gastrin on intestinal calcium absorption (CaA), serum/plasma insulin, glucagon, parathyroid hormone, calcitonin, glucose, calcium and protein was measured in healthy adult males. Intravenous infusion of pentagastrin (PG. 6 micrograms/kg/h) resulted in a slight decrease of CaA (53.5 +/- (SEM) 5.8% of administered tracer vs. saline control 67.4 +/- 3.4, p less than 0.05). To exclude the influence of hormones like insulin, glucagon and calcitonin stimulated by PG, somatostatin was infused in additional trials. From these experiments and the infusion of synthetic human gastrin-17 (250 ng/kg/h) into 2 subjects, we conclude that acute infusion of gastrin lowers CaA in man.

Clinical and laboratory data, histologic, electron microscopic and immunocytochemical findings of the tumors of eight patients suffering from Cushing's syndrome and of one patient with hypercalcemia are described. The unlabeled antibody enzyme method was used for the detection of insulin, glucagon, somatostatin, pancreatic polypeptide, corticotropin, beta-lipotropin, calcitonin, parathyroid hormone, and gastrin. Ectopic Cushing's syndrome was caused by pancreatic endocrine tumors, medullary thyroid carcinoma, a bronchial, a gastric and a thymic carcinoid, and a carcinoid of the mediastinum. Hypercalcemia in one patient was related to a pancreatic endocrine tumor. After surgery the clinical symptoms disappeared in two patients, but persisted or relapsed in five patients. ACTH-immunoreactivity could be demonstrated in six of eight tumors; calcitonin-immunoreactivity was found in the tumor of the patient suffering from hypercalcemia. ACTH-immunoreactivity could be localized to secretory granules by immunoelectron microscopy, and the presence of ACTH and beta-LPH in the same tumor cells could be shown in one pancreatic tumor. A combination of production of orthotopic and ectopic hormones was found in one, and secretion of two ectopic hormones was detected in another pancreatic endocrine tumor.

In order to evaluate the possible causal relationship between raised serum gastrin levels and the development of primary hyperparathyroidism (HPT) which is suggested from experimental studies we evaluated parathyroid function in a group of 32 patients with hypergastrinaemia and pernicious anaemia. The values for serum calcium and parathyroid hormone were determined as well as the fasting urinary excretions of cyclic AMP and calcium. There was no relationship between the serum gastrin levels and any of the other studied parameters and there was no consistent pattern suggesting parathyroid hyperfunction. A retrospective analysis of hospital records from 441 patients operated for primary HPT showed a prevalence of pernicious anaemia of 1.8%. This figure is higher than that found in the unselected age-matched population (0.31%). However, taken together this study does not support the hypothesis that hypergastrinaemia is of particular importance for the pathogenesis of primary HPT.

We have developed and validated a double-antibody radioimmunoassay for quantifying bovine calcium-binding protein (CaBP). Cross-reactivity between the antiserum and microgram quantities of thyrocalcitonin, calmodulin, gastrin, cholecystokinin, vasoactive intestinal polypeptide, serum albumin and concentrated extract of bovine pituitary gland was insignificant. Slight cross-reactivity (6%) of the antiserum with parathyroid hormone was demonstrated. Assay sensitivity was .25 ng/ml and intraassay and interassay coefficients of variation ranged from 4 to 11% and 10 to 24%, respectively. The CaBP immunoreactivity was not affected by endogenous Ca concentrations. Plasma and serum concentrations of immunoreactive CaBP were similar. The CaBP concentrations were unaffected when coagulated and anticoagulated blood samples were stored at 4 or 22 C for up to 72 h and when serum was stored at -20, 4 or 22 C for 8 d. Serum CaBP concentrations in cattle were not affected by gonadal steroids, but may have been influenced by age. Treatment with 500 mg of vitamin D3, but not 50 mg of dihydrotachysterol, significantly increased serum Ca and CaBP concentrations in Holstein heifers after a lag period of 7 to 10 d. Serum Ca and CaBP concentrations began to increase in serum at approximately the same time and both exhibited parallel responses to treatment with vitamin D3. Serum Ca concentrations were positively correlated (r = .81) with CaBP concentrations and this relationship was described by the equation, Y = 6.85 + 1.01X - .03X2. Serum Ca and CaBP concentrations were still elevated in heifers 75 d after initial treatment with vitamin D3. The radioimmunoassay we describe provides an opportunity to investigate the role of CaBP in Ca homeostasis during growth, pregnancy, lactation, parturient paresis and other physiological and pathological states in cattle.

An unusual tumor of the cystic duct in a 28-year-old woman is described. The patient presented with a painful distended gallbladder due to a small tumor occluding the cystic duct. Microscopically the tumor cells showed a nesting pattern suggestive of endocrine differentiation, but contained numerous lipid vacuoles and were argentaffin and argyrophil negative. Ultrastructurally, there were relatively few dense granules measuring 135 to 475 nm. Immunoperoxidase staining showed that the tumor cells contained somatostatin but did not contain immunoreactive ACTH, gastrin, calcitonin, glucagon, insulin, parathyroid hormone, or carcinoembryonic antigen. To the authors' knowledge, this is the first reported somatostatinoma occurring in the extrahepatic biliary tract.

The prevalence of hypergastrinemia was determined in 38 consecutive patients with proved primary hyperparathyroidism. Uncorrected serum calcium levels ranged from 2.6 to 4.0 mmol/L and parathyroid hormone levels from 260 to 8750 ng/L (normal less than 600 ng/L). Preoperative serum gastrin levels were grossly elevated (1000 to 4000 ng/L) in three patients (normal median 63 ng/L; range 30 to 120 ng/L). Two patients were achlorhydric. After parathyroidectomy (adenomatous hyperplasia) in the third patient, the serum gastrin level decreased from 4000 to 3000 ng/L, with a negative response to both a secretin challenge and a meal test. The latter patient was subsequently shown to have an adrenal ganglioneuroma and islet cell hyperplasia, neither containing gastrin, and at 4-year follow-up she still has no symptoms from the hypergastrinemia. Eight patients had a modest hypergastrinemia. Serum gastrin levels returned to normal in three of the four patients after parathyroidectomy. The fourth patient had rheumatoid arthritis, which can be associated with hypergastrinemia. The mean plasma gastrin level before operation (100.3 +/- 26.1 ng/L) was similar to the postoperative value (67.0 +/- 18.5 ng/L). There was no correlation between parathyroid hormone and gastrin levels nor between serum calcium and gastrin levels. The three patients with duodenal ulcers did not have elevated gastrin levels. Therefore it would appear that routine screening of patients with primary hyperparathyroidism adds little to their clinical management.

Bombesin, a peptide with widespread biological actions, has been demonstrated in human tissues by immunological methods. To investigate its effect in man, synthetic bombesin was infused at low doses in six male volunteers. Bombesin at 2.4 pmol kg-1 min-1 produced significant rises in plasma insulin, glucagon, pancreatic polypeptide, gastrin, cholecystokinin, motilin, glucose-dependent insulinotropic polypeptide, neurotensin, enteroglucagon, vasoactive intestinal polypeptide, and serum calcium. In contrast, bombesin caused a profound fall in parathyroid hormone levels and reduced plasma glucose concentrations. A late rise in plasma calcitonin was also observed. Bombesin had no significant effect on the pituitary hormones, TSH, GH, PRL, or cortisol. No hormonal changes or alterations in calcium were noted during saline infusions. Bombesin has a marked stimulatory effect on gastrointestinal hormones, which is unique and opposite to the effect of somatostatin, a potent inhibitor of gut hormone release. Bombesin also influences calcium-regulating hormones, either directly or through its action on gut hormones. The bombesin concentrations achieved with the dosages used were low enough to indicate a possible physiological role for the endogenous peptide.
